Blaspheme against holy spirit. Defining Terms. Blasphemy – speaking evil against or reviling (in this context, this is against God) Son of Man – Jesus, the second person of the Godhead; specific emphasis on His incarnation (Hebrews 2:14) Holy Spirit – third person of the Godhead; His role was to reveal God’s word (John 15:26; 16:13; 1 Corinthians 2:10-13)

Blasphemy against the Holy Spirit is to refuse God’s mercy. It is a refusal to repent of sin. God does not bring anyone into his kingdom against his/her will. Human persons have the ability to reject God’s mercy and refuse forgiveness of sins which leads to eternal separation from God. Repent and you’re fine.

Jesus spoke of a special type of blasphemy—blasphemy against the Holy Spirit—committed by the religious leaders of His day. The situation was that the Pharisees were eyewitnesses to Jesus’ miracles, but they attributed the work of the Holy Spirit to the presence of a demon (Mark 3:22-30). Their portrayal of the … The blasphemy against the Holy Spirit, in this context, is the public attributing of the work of the Holy Spirit, through Jesus Christ, to Satan. The Holy Spirit testified of Jesus’ identity as the promised Messiah. Refusal to acknowledge this obvious testimony of the work of God was blaspheming the Holy Spirit. Rather, blaspheming the Holy Spirit is a mindset that is firmly set against God and unwilling to acknowledge Him even when one knows that they should. The phrase "blaspheme the Holy Spirit" is found only in Matthew 12:31-32, Mark 3:28-29 and Luke 12:8-10, and all three of these passages convey the same teaching by Jesus Christ.
